Comprehending Disability Scooters
Disability scooters are electric cars developed to assist people with mobility impairments. These scooters can be found in various sizes and shapes, making it easier for users to browse through indoor and outside environments.
Kinds Of Disability Scooters
When thinking about a disability scooter, it is necessary to comprehend the numerous types available in the market:
TypeDescriptionBenefits3-Wheel ScootersSuitable for indoor usage due to their tight turning radius.Simpler to navigate in small spaces.4-Wheel ScootersProvide better stability, safety, and improved outdoor performance.Appropriate for unequal surfaces and longer distances.Heavy-Duty ScootersDesigned for bigger people, these scooters can deal with more weight and deal boosted sturdiness.Increased weight capability and robust features.Folding ScootersCompact and quickly collapsible, making them best for travel.Portable, lightweight, and easy to store.All-Terrain ScootersGeared up for a range of surface areas, from rough surface to pavement.Suitable for outside activity and experience.Advantages of Using Disability Scooters
Disability scooters offer various advantages that contribute favorably to people' lives. These include:
Enhanced Mobility: Users can travel longer distances without physical stress, permitting for greater liberty and mobility.Self-reliance: Scooters enable people to maintain their self-reliance in day-to-day activities, such as shopping, participating in events, or going to good friends.Improved Safety: Many scooters come with functions like lights, indications, and anti-tip systems that enhance user safety.Convenience: Many designs use cushioned seats, adjustable armrests, and easy to use controls, making them comfy for extended usage.Versatility: Mobility scooters can be utilized indoors and outdoors, making them a practical choice for various environments.Finding Disability Scooters Nearby

Picking the best mobility scooter includes numerous considerations:
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can securely support the user's weight.Variety: Consider how far the scooter can travel on a complete charge, catering to the user's requirements.Seat Comfort: Look for an ergonomic seat that supplies proper support, specifically for longer journeys.Mobility: If taking a trip often, consider a folding scooter for ease of transport.Terrain: Choose a scooter designed for the type of environment you'll be using it in-- whether it's smooth walkways or rugged surfaces.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Just how much do disability scooters cost?
The cost of disability scooters varies considerably based on features, type, and brand name. Normally, prices can vary from ₤ 800 to over ₤ 3,000.
2. Do I require a prescription to buy a mobility scooter?
A prescription is not typically needed for buying a mobility scooter, however it might be necessary for insurance coverage.
3. Can I use a disability scooter without a chauffeur's license?
Yes, people can operate mobility scooters without a motorist's license, as they are not categorized as motor cars.
4. How quick can disability scooters go?
A lot of mobility scooters have a speed variety of 4 to 8 miles per hour, depending on the design.
5. Can I take my scooter on mass transit?
Numerous public transport services accommodate mobility scooters, however checking with the particular transportation authority for guidelines and availability is advisable.
